How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Bryn Mawr?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Bryn Mawr Studio Apartments | $1,084 | $615 | $1,599 |
Bryn Mawr 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,414 | $607 | $2,500 |
Bryn Mawr 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,757 | $769 | $3,680 |
Bryn Mawr 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,848 | $999 | $5,280 |
Bryn Mawr 4 Bedroom Apartments | $6,200 | $5,500 | $6,900 |
